Article: The Houston Business Show Is Proud to Introduce the New Advisor, Larry Korkmas

Larry Korkmas is the owner of Commercial Dispute Resolution Associates, a mediation and arbitration provider and is still active in the commercial and industrial real estate business. He is a prolific writer, a number of his articles have appeared in various real estate publications including Red News and he has authored a number of MCE commercial real estate courses.
